Bengaluru, February 2, 2026: The Anushikshan Program successfully conducted an AI showcase event on 2nd February 2026 at Government PU College, Bengaluru. Supported by Amadeus, the event provided students with a platform to present projects developed during their AI training sessions and demonstrate the skills acquired through the program.

The showcase event marked the conclusion of structured artificial intelligence learning modules implemented at the institution as part of the Anushikshan Program. Students showcased a variety of AI-based projects, reflecting their understanding of core concepts such as logical reasoning, data interpretation, and problem-solving.
